About the Book

Theodore John Swystun's "Advancing Professionalism in the Humanitarian Sector" addresses the practical aspects of identifying and disseminating the rapidly growing body of technical knowledge for the management of humanitarian interventions, as well as the development of a professional core within the sector. Its rich documentation and analysis is designed to facilitate the rapid design of training programs and course modules for humanitarian assistance, disaster relief, and conflict workers, enabling them to better protect and aid the victims of natural and man-made disasters.Informed by a structural-functionalist theoretical framework and a constructivist perspective, Swystun examines the current drive toward professionalization within the humanitarian sector. The current and future state of Humanitarian Assistance and Disaster Relief (HADR) need is explored and the generally accepted model of the HADR community is critically examined, with an alternative full-spectrum model presented. Against this model, key actors are identified and the context in which they interact to service HADR requirements scrutinized. Core professional competencies necessary to facilitate that interaction, now and in the future, are identified. These core competencies are then referenced against the available literature of best practices and technical knowledge to ultimately arrive at a uniform professional body of knowledge, upon which a program of professionalism and training can be based. Various requirements and mechanisms for training delivery are explored and the current community focus on establishing a professional association is critically examined. About the Author: Theodore John Swystun is a Certified Management Consultant and a former member of the Board of Directors of the Institute of Management Consultants (USA), with twenty five years of international experience advising public and private sector clients on complex strategic, operational, and organizational issues. Prior to the Second Gulf War, Mr. Swystun served in Kuwait as an advisor to the Kuwait Ministry of Planning and the Kuwait Council of Ministers under contract to the United Nations. He has consulted to international governmental organizations, national governments, and INGOs on recovery and development in post conflict and transitional economies and is considered an expert in aligning organizational structures, policies, and procedures to strategic goals. "Advancing Professionalism in the Humanitarian Sector" is the product of his research at the Centre for Advanced Studies of the University of Basel, Switzerland.
